Transaction 31ed600d7ac2a6f6e534f70102366d9fcaa715d4508bd3fc3c155bd88d80d5de
1 Input
2 Outputs
- 31ed600d7ac2a6f6e534f70102366d9fcaa715d4508bd3fc3c155bd88d80d5de:0
- 31ed600d7ac2a6f6e534f70102366d9fcaa715d4508bd3fc3c155bd88d80d5de:1
value 558767
address 1AvdhXAWCF332KgV52KnNhAcrowWVhUsmf
value 354369
address 3JP6WYVpmVRkSCZWWiXtfFuUUGWB4rqpSy